Our March cruise was canceled. We opted for the OBC, and applied our deposit to our October cruise, which isn't looking to promising now... if our October cruise gets canceled also, and we opt to apply it to another cruise too, will we get $300 more in OBC giving us a total of $600, for not getting a refund for either cruise?

 

Our final payment date is August 1, so we are just trying to figure out all of our options.

when you book your new cruise you lose your old promos from your last cruise. So if your October cruise had $50 OBC as a booking promo plus the $300 for the cancellation - and you want to move to an April cruise next year that carries a $100 OBC booking promo; your Oct OBC would go away and you would get the April promo $100 plus the rebooking $300..
